Academic Programmes
Degree programmes
-Two principle passes in relevant subjects and a subsidiary for advanced level certificate. (at least 4.5 points)
-Minimum of three credits in ordinary level certificate
-Diploma from a recognized Institution of higher learning with an average of B for equivalent qualification

  • Bachelor of Arts Business Administration (BBA)
  • Bachelor of Education (BED)
  • Bachelor of Business Administration with Education
  • (BBA with Education)
  • Bachelor of Office Administration.
  • Bachelor of Arts in Theology (BTh)
  • Bachelor of Arts in Religious Studies
